William Turton / Gizmodo:
This Is Probably Why Half the Internet Shut Down Today  —  Twitter, Spotify and Reddit, and a huge swath of other websites were down or screwed up this morning.  This was happening as hackers unleashed a large distributed denial of service (DDoS) attack on the servers of Dyn, a major DNS host.

Bridget Kelly: Christie Knew About GWB Lane Closures A Month Ahead Of Time  —  In bombshell testimony Friday, Bridget Anne Kelly said that she told New Jersey Gov. Chris Christie (R) that access lanes to the George Washington Bridge would be closed for a traffic study a month before the plan actually was carried out in September 2013.
